Members of the HPS Rutland Group were kindly invited to join the Rippingale and District Gardening Club for a July morning visit to the gardens at Burghley House. As well as viewing the public gardens and hearing about their 500 year old history, care today including environmental challenges, and plans for development as the gardens evolve, Head Gardener Joe Whitehead took us “behind the scenes” for a fascinating tour of the private and parkland areas beside Capability’s Lake. Joe also talked about the heritage of the trees and their care. A particular highlight being the multi-stemmed Cryptomeria japonica. Thank you to Joe for his interesting and amusing tour.
